Transaction e9895338ae098f77cb682841b51aa72c22056f3d904aa754a236b56159059b45
1 Input
1 Output
-
e9895338ae098f77cb682841b51aa72c22056f3d904aa754a236b56159059b45:0
- value
- 189492
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2217720c4d3eab53ecebb36e8907aaaf94ff4951 OP_EQUAL
- address
- 34oGz63xFxcXu4KTEmwmqdYVW8tuSzJXoS